Why did I specialize in working with trauma using the EMDR method?
EMDR allows us to address a specific problem you bring – such as difficulties in relationships, depression, anxiety, or feelings of inadequacy – in a structured way. We don’t waste time circling around the issue; we go straight to the core.
In EMDR therapy, we connect thinking with feeling – both emotional and bodily – and this integration allows problems to be fully processed.
EMDR therapy invites you, as the client, to take responsibility for your own change – I accompany you and create the conditions for it, but with EMDR the transformation happens on a deeper emotional level, making it more lasting.
